Let the show begin

September 30, 2021

The Commission on Elections will start accepting today the Certificates of Candidacy of those vying for elective positions in the May 9, 2022 polls.
Data from the COMELEC show that there are 18,180 seats in the government that will be filled up next year, from national, local and the Bangsamoro Autonomous Region in Muslim Mindanao.

Ananoria back as NegOcc poll supervisor

September 30, 2021

The Commission on Elections designated Atty. Ian Lee Ananoria as the acting provincial Comelec supervisor (PES) of Negros Occidental.
Comelec Western Visayas assistant regional director, Tomas Valera, said that Ananoria replaced Atty. Ma Fatima Aspan, who returns to her previous position as election officer of Victorias City.

Negros Weekly news magazine was founded on November 11, 2000 by a group of civic leaders and local journalists headed by Journalism Professor Allen V. Del Carmen. The publication offers news, features, and opinion articles for Negros Occidental readers. It also accepts printing jobs, graphic designs, legal notices and ad placements.*
